Explanation / Answer

2.anterior - any part which lies in the front of body ( facing forward when divided by frontal plane)

3.lateral- the part of body lying away from the main trunk or any other part away from midline.

4.superior- any part which lies above to other ( having upper position in transverse plane)

inferior- any part which lies below to other( having lower position in transverse plane)

5.proximal- the part of body which is closer to the trunk when compared to other.

distal- the part of the body which is away from the trunk or midline.
